Concrete Raising in San Antonio, TX

Concrete raising services are designed to restore the levelness of sunken or uneven concrete surfaces, such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. This process involves lifting and leveling existing concrete slabs without the need for full replacement, making it a practical solution for addressing common issues caused by soil settling, erosion, or freeze-thaw cycles. Homeowners often request this service to improve safety, prevent further damage, and enhance the appearance of their property’s exterior spaces.

Before requesting concrete raising,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the sinking or cracking, the condition of the existing slab, and whether the surface can be effectively leveled without additional repairs. It’s also helpful to consider the location of the project, as certain areas may require specialized techniques or materials. Clear communication about the project’s scope and the desired outcome can help ensure the best results for restoring a smooth, safe surface.

FAQ

Concrete Raising Questions

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that restores s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by lifting them back to their original position.

What types of projects benefit from concrete raising? Dri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ors often benefit from this method to improve safety and appearance.

How does concrete raising work? The process involves injecting a lightweight material beneath the slab to lift and level the surface efficiently.

Is concrete raising a permanent solution? It provides a long-lasting fix for uneven concrete, helping to prevent further settling or cracking over time.
